My Buying Guides on Flat Red Spray Paint

What I Look for in Flat Red Spray Paint

When I shop for flat red spray paint, I first focus on the finish. I want a true flat look, not a semi-matte or satin result that reflects more light than I expect. I also pay attention to the shade of red, since some sprays lean toward bright fire-engine red while others look deeper or more muted. For my projects, I choose a color that matches the surface and the style I want.

Why I Prefer Flat Finish Paint

I like flat finish paint because it hides small flaws better than glossy paint. On older surfaces, this makes a big difference. The non-reflective look also gives my projects a clean, modern, and understated appearance. If I want the surface to look smooth without drawing attention to imperfections, flat red spray paint is usually my first choice.

Surface Compatibility Matters

Before buying, I always check what surfaces the paint works on. Some flat red spray paints are designed for metal, wood, plastic, or multi-surface use. I make sure the product can bond well to the material I’m painting so I don’t end up with peeling or uneven coverage. If I’m painting something outdoors, I also look for weather-resistant or rust-preventive formulas.

Coverage and Drying Time

Coverage is important to me because I want good results without using too many cans. I read the label to see how much area one can covers. Drying time matters too, especially when I’m working on a tight schedule. I usually choose a spray paint that dries quickly to the touch but still gives me enough time to apply even coats.

Durability and Protection

I look for paint that can hold up over time. If the item will be handled often or exposed to sunlight, moisture, or outdoor conditions, I want a durable formula. Some flat red spray paints offer extra protection against fading, chipping, or rust. That gives me more confidence that my work will stay looking good longer.

Ease of Application

A good spray can should feel comfortable in my hand and spray evenly without clogging. I prefer products with a smooth nozzle and consistent spray pattern because they help me get a cleaner finish. If I can apply the paint in light, even coats without drips, I know the product is worth considering.

Safety and Ventilation

I never ignore safety. I check whether the paint has strong fumes and make sure I can use it in a well-ventilated area. I also wear gloves and a mask when needed. If I’m painting indoors or in a garage, I look for low-odor options when possible.
